When eight men working at the Tsalal Arctic Research Station in Ennis, Alaska disappear on December 17, during the last sunset of the year before ‘the long night’, Chief of Police Liz Danvers (Jodie Foster, pictured left) is first on the scene.

The case seems entirely baffling by itself, but when she comes across the tongue of an unrelated Native woman at the deserted facility, her mind starts spinning.

When the men’s naked bodies are subsequently discovered frozen into a “giant block of flesh” by local woman Rose (Fiona Shaw, True Blood, watch On Demand), seemingly petrified to death and suffering bizarre self-inflicted wounds, it’s just the tip of the iceberg.
